Your camera model is one of a number of cameras that had defective CCD imager's installed. These CCD's were produced by Sony and installed in multiple brands of cameras. There was a time when Sony would have repaired this problem for your for free, but has since stopped this offer. Canon, on the other hand is still repairing this problem for free for a number of their cameras that had the Sony CCD installed.
